How long can cooked pasta be left out?

Bacteria multiply rapidly at temperatures ranging from 40 degrees Fahrenheit to 140 degrees Fahrenheit. Discard cooked pasta if it has been at room temperature for more than two hours.

Can you get sick from eating leftover pasta?

Raw rice and pasta may contain spores of B. cereus, a common and widespread bacteria in our environment. In particular, B. cereus can survive even after the food has been properly cooked.

How long can you eat pasta after cooking?

To maximize the shelf life of cooked pasta for safety and quality, refrigerate pasta in shallow airtight containers or resealable plastic bags. Properly stored, cooked pasta will keep for 3-5 days in the refrigerator.

Is it safe to eat food left out overnight?

Perishable foods (such as meat and poultry) may not be safe if left at room temperature overnight (more than 2 hours). Discard it even if it looks and smells good. Do not taste food to see if it has gone bad. Use a food thermometer to check temperature.

Is it okay to eat dry pasta?

Dried pasta does not pose a serious risk of food poisoning when eaten fresh. The moisture content of pasta is essentially zero, which means bacteria cannot grow on it. If allowed to get wet or damp, noodles can grow bacteria that can cause food poisoning.

What happens if you eat food left out overnight?

The USDA says food left out of the refrigerator for more than two hours should be thrown away. At room temperature, bacteria can grow very fast and make you sick. Reheating something that has been sitting at room temperature for more than two hours is not safe from bacteria.
